I’m a Proverbs 31 Failure

“A wife of noble character, who can find?”

Recently, as my husband read aloud from Proverbs 31 over the breakfast table, I wondered if maybe that was a rhetorical question. As in, “can anyone find this woman?” She has an extensive list of accomplishments and abilities. She seems to be able to “do it all,” with skill (check out all the details here). Am I really supposed to be like her?

Twizzlers for Everyone (or How I Missed the Point)

by Jonathan

It’s often called Golden.  It’s too simple.  It’s nearly impossible to implement in real life, but according to Jesus, it sums up pretty much the entire Bible (at the time of writing).

It is, of course, the Golden Rule, and it goes something like this, “Do for others what you would like them to do for you.  This is a summary of all that is taught in the law and the prophets.”
